news 2026/4/16 6:03:08

零基础入门ArchiMate建模:Archi工具极速安装与配置指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
零基础入门ArchiMate建模:Archi工具极速安装与配置指南

零基础入门ArchiMate建模:Archi工具极速安装与配置指南

【免费下载链接】archiArchi: ArchiMate Modelling Tool项目地址: https://gitcode.com/gh_mirrors/arc/archi

想要快速掌握企业架构建模?ArchiMate建模工具Archi为您提供了完美的入门解决方案。作为一款开源的跨平台建模软件,Archi让架构设计变得简单直观,无论您是初学者还是专业人士,都能在5分钟内完成安装并开始创建专业的架构模型。

🎯 准备工作与环境要求

在开始安装之前,请确保您的系统满足以下基本要求:

  • Java环境:JDK 11或更高版本(推荐OpenJDK)
  • 构建工具:Maven 3.6+
  • 操作系统:支持Windows、macOS和Linux

🚀 三步完成Archi安装

第一步:获取项目源代码

首先需要下载Archi的完整项目代码到本地:

git clone https://gitcode.com/gh_mirrors/arc/archi.git cd archi

第二步:一键构建项目

使用Maven命令快速构建整个项目,系统会自动处理所有依赖关系:

mvn clean install

这个过程可能需要几分钟时间,具体取决于您的网络速度和系统配置。

第三步:启动应用程序

构建完成后,通过以下方式启动Archi:

mvn exec:java -Dexec.mainClass="com.archimatetool.editor.Application"

成功启动后,您将看到Archi的主界面,左侧是模型树结构,右侧是元素库,中央是绘图区域。

📊 核心功能快速上手

直观的建模界面

Archi提供了清晰的工作区布局,让您能够专注于架构设计而不被复杂的界面困扰。新手用户也能快速找到所需功能。

丰富的建模元素

工具内置了完整的ArchiMate元素库,包括业务层、应用层、技术层等各个架构域的标准元素。

🔧 实用配置技巧

开发环境优化

如果您计划进行二次开发,建议配置以下开发环境:

  • IDE选择:Eclipse或IntelliJ IDEA
  • 插件安装:EMF、GEF等Eclipse插件

快速启动参数

为提升使用体验,可以添加启动参数:

mvn exec:java -Dexec.mainClass="com.archimatetool.editor.Application" -Dexec.args="-consoleLog"

🌟 进阶功能探索

专业建模示例

Archi支持创建复杂的业务架构模型,如保险业务场景的角色与服务交互:

报告生成功能

工具内置强大的报告生成器,能够将您的架构模型导出为专业的文档:

通过报告功能,您可以生成信息结构视图、业务流程视图等多种格式的架构文档。

💡 常见问题解决方案

构建失败处理

如果遇到构建问题,尝试以下方法:

# 清理并重新构建 mvn clean install -U # 跳过测试快速构建 mvn clean install -DskipTests

依赖冲突排查

对于依赖问题,可以使用依赖树分析:

mvn dependency:tree -Dverbose

🎉 开始您的建模之旅

恭喜!您已经成功安装并配置了ArchiMate建模工具Archi。现在可以开始创建您的第一个架构模型,探索企业架构设计的无限可能。

记住,实践是最好的学习方式。多尝试不同的建模技巧,您将很快掌握ArchiMate建模的精髓,为企业架构设计增添专业价值。

如需了解更多高级功能和定制开发,请参考项目中的官方文档和示例代码。祝您建模愉快!

【免费下载链接】archiArchi: ArchiMate Modelling Tool项目地址: https://gitcode.com/gh_mirrors/arc/archi

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/11 5:01:21

Bodymovin扩展面板:After Effects动画导出终极解决方案

Bodymovin扩展面板:After Effects动画导出终极解决方案 【免费下载链接】bodymovin-extension Bodymovin UI extension panel 项目地址: https://gitcode.com/gh_mirrors/bod/bodymovin-extension 开篇痛点:传统动画制作的困境 你是否曾经为了在…

作者头像 李华
网站建设 2026/4/15 11:30:28

通过GitHub Wiki建立ms-swift内部知识库

通过GitHub Wiki构建ms-swift高效知识管理体系 在大模型研发日益工程化的今天,团队面临的挑战早已从“能不能跑通”转向“如何规模化落地”。当一个项目涉及上百种模型架构、多种微调策略与分布式训练配置时,技术文档不再只是辅助工具——它本身就是系统…

作者头像 李华
网站建设 2026/4/13 8:47:49

ms-swift支持异常输入检测防御对抗样本攻击

ms-swift 如何构建可信大模型的“免疫系统”? 在生成式 AI 爆发式落地的今天,一个隐忧正悄然浮现:模型越强大,攻击面也越广。从简单的提示词注入到复杂的多模态对抗样本,恶意输入正在以越来越隐蔽的方式穿透系统的防线…

作者头像 李华
网站建设 2026/4/14 2:08:55

使用WebAssembly加速前端展示ms-swift评测结果

使用WebAssembly加速前端展示ms-swift评测结果 在大模型研发日益工业化、标准化的今天,一个常被忽视但至关重要的环节浮出水面:如何高效地查看和理解模型评测结果。传统流程中,我们训练完模型,执行一次 swift eval 命令&#xff0…

作者头像 李华
网站建设 2026/4/15 20:32:38

告别Excel算薪,人力资源管理系统破解制造业考勤薪酬联动难题

【导读】 在制造行业内,每逢月初,HR往往要在考勤机、纸质请假条、Excel表和各种微信群截图之间来回穿梭,同时处理几千名一线员工的加班、夜班、高温补贴、计件工资,一点算错就可能引发整条产线的不满——随着订单波动、班次调整和…

作者头像 李华
网站建设 2026/4/7 7:45:35

终极指南:如何在5分钟内快速安装PolyglotPDF跨语言PDF处理工具

终极指南:如何在5分钟内快速安装PolyglotPDF跨语言PDF处理工具 【免费下载链接】PolyglotPDF (PDF translation)Multilingual PDF processing tool, supports online and offline translation while maintaining original layout; performs OCR on scanned PDFs, fa…

作者头像 李华